Title:
FLUIDIZED BED FURNACE

Abstract:

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a new fluidized bed furnace suitable for the use of a high-temperature large-diameter fluidized bed furnace, of light-weight, having excellent strength properties and positively making use of a nonfluidic bulk material as a pressure maintaining medium for a fluidized bulk material.
SOLUTION: The fluidized bed furnace comprises reaction gas supplying vertically rising tubes 6 arranged at the bottom thereof, and air diffuser boxes 7, which communicate with the vertically rising tubes 6, horizontally arranged therein. The vertically rising tubes 6 are partially composed of telescopic members 8. The reaction gas is ejected into the furnace through the vertically rising tubes 6 and spaces in the air diffuser boxes 7 to form a fluidized bed 14 on the air diffuser boxes 7. A fluidized bed furnace 1 contains a nonfluidic bulk material 12 on the bottom thereof and the air diffuser boxes 7 are placed on the nonfluidic bulk material 12.
